About the role
LRH is seeking to appoint an enthusiastic Surgical Unaccredited Registrar on a fixed term fulltime basis (86 hours per fortnight).
The role of the Surgical Registrar is to provide day-to-day medical care for patients under the direction of senior medical staff and also work as part of a multidisciplinary team to provide safe and high-quality patient care. The successful applicant will support LRH’s Values - Person-Centred, Respect, Integrity, Excellence and Working Together.
About the Department
The Surgical Department is focused on providing quality care to the patients and wider community. In Anaesthetics you will be provided with many exciting opportunities and experience a broad range of clinical practices and caseloads. You will experience more one-on-one time with supervising Consultants and also see a rich range of presentations and be provided with many educational opportunities.
About you
Ideal candidates for this role will have:
- Bachelor of Medicine/Bachelor of Surgery (MBBS) or equivalent
- Registration or be eligible for registration with Australian Health Practitioner Regulation Agency (AHPRA)
- Completed and passed AMC Part 1 as a minimum (Part 2 is desirable)
- Excellent interpersonal and communication skills
- Demonstrated ability to work effectively as a team member

About us
Located in the picturesque region of Gippsland, Latrobe Regional Health (LRH) offers the perfect balance between career and lifestyle. Enjoy easy access to Melbourne, stunning beaches, majestic mountains, and serene lakes. With flexible working hours, you can make the most of what Gippsland has to offer.
LRH cares for a population of about 300,000 and is the regional provider of specialist services. Our catchment covers 42,000 square kilometres, from Phillip Island to Mallacoota in the far east of Victoria. LRH offers cardiac care, surgery, medical, renal, emergency care, aged care, women's and children's services, pharmacy, allied health and rehabilitation. Medical and radiation oncology are offered by the Gippsland Cancer Care Centre.
Now is an exciting time to join the LRH team, with the $223.5 million expansion completed in March 2024, offering improved maternity and paediatric facilities, larger intensive care unit, increased medical and surgical beds and additional operating theatres.
